Output 8045628cf6fcdaecfb04ea2f753dc665e632e8f2ea87d4b8bb20da020c9540bf:1

value
414357
script pubkey
OP_0 OP_PUSHBYTES_20 27dbe9d29afc54f18e32d31b0b8637b1906b95c5
address
bc1qyld7n556l320rr3j6vdshp3hkxgxh9w94xk8ke
transaction
8045628cf6fcdaecfb04ea2f753dc665e632e8f2ea87d4b8bb20da020c9540bf
confirmations
191814
spent
true